Position Overview: We are seeking a talented Estimator with specialized expertise in property development to join our dynamic team in Middlesborough. As an Estimator,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the success of our projects by accurately assessing costs, preparing detailed estimates, and providing valuable insights to inform decision-making.
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with project stakeholders to understand project requirements, specifications, and timelines.
- Conduct thorough analysis of project plans, drawings, and specifications to identify materials, labour, and other cost components.
- Prepare accurate and comprehensive cost estimates for property development projects, including detailed breakdowns of labour, materials, subcontractor costs, and overheads.
- Research market trends, material costs, and subcontractor rates to ensure estimates are competitive and reflective of current market conditions.
- Work closely with procurement teams to obtain quotes, negotiate prices, and secure contracts with suppliers and subcontractors.
- Provide ongoing support to project teams by monitoring costs, identifying cost-saving opportunities, and addressing any variations or discrepancies.
